St. Joseph High School

Since 1915 in a tradition of excellence, Saint Joseph High School has offered a college preparatory education grounded in the Gospel values of Jesus Christ and served the families in the Alle-Kiski Valley.
The school creates an environment that nurtures the whole person by encouraging spiritual growth, academic excellence, extracurricular participation, and service outreach.
Our mission is to graduate men and women who are committed to holiness, justice, integrity, and learning.

Advanced Courses
Algebra II (weighted), Art History through La Roche College, Biology (weighted), Calculus through Univ of Pittsburgh, Catholic Social Justice through Carlow Univ, Civiliation II through La Roche College, English 11 and 12 through La Roche College, Foundation of the Republic through La Roche College, French IV (weighted), Genetics (weighted), Latin IV through Univ of Pittsburgh, Macroeconomics through La Roche College, Physics II (weighted), Pre Calculus (weighted), Psychology through St. Vincent College, Spanish IV (weighted), Statistics through Univ of Pittsburgh

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does St. Joseph High School cost?
St. Joseph High School's tuition is approximately $6,750 for private students.
What sports does St. Joseph High School offer?
St. Joseph High School offers 11 interscholastic sports: Baseball, Basketball, Bowling, Cheering, Golf, Soccer, Softball, Swimming, Tennis, Track and Field and Volleyball.
What is St. Joseph High School's ranking?
St. Joseph High School ranks among the top 20% of private schools in Pennsylvania for: Highest percentage of faculty with advanced degrees and Oldest founding date.
When is the application deadline for St. Joseph High School?
The application deadline for St. Joseph High School is rolling (applications are reviewed as they are received year-round).
